Jay-Z has shared his experience of New York's subway system in a new online documentary film, which shows him chatting with an old lady on his way to a show in Brooklyn.

The woman, who introduces herself as Ellen, asks Jay-Z what he does for a living and he replies, "I make music... (I'm) not very famous, you don't know me. I'll get there some day... I'm on my way to a performance in Brooklyn at the new Brooklyn arena."

Ellen tells the star, "Oh, that's fabulous... And you are going by subway? I'm proud of you."

She then asks him to repeat his name, and adds, "Oh! You're Jay-Z? I know about Jay-Z."

The film, posted on YouTube.com, also shows Jay-Z rehearsing for his shows and hanging out with his wife, Beyonce, backstage.
